J.J. Thomson successfully completed his investigation into the nature of cathode rays due to his innovative use of a cathode ray tube, which allowed him to observe the behavior of charged particles. His meticulous experiments demonstrated that these rays were composed of negatively charged particles, later named electrons. Additionally, Thomson's application of electromagnetic fields to manipulate the rays provided critical insights into their properties, enabling him to measure their charge-to-mass ratio accurately. This combination of experimental technique and theoretical insight was key to his groundbreaking discoveries in atomic structure.
